High Load-Bearing Capacity
Concrete sleepers are engineered for maximum strength, capable of withstanding significant lateral earth pressure across unstable or reactive clay soils. Their solid mass provides exceptional resistance to shifting ground, making them ideal for retaining walls in high-stress applications.
Superior Long-Term Durability
Unlike timber, concrete sleepers resist rot, termites, and UV degradation. When installed correctly, they maintain structural integrity for decades, even in high-moisture environments such as sloped or low-lying sites common in Epping and Wallan.
Corrosion-Resistant Strength with Galvanised Steel Posts
Galvanised steel posts offer exceptional resistance to rust and moisture damage thanks to their zinc coating. This protective layer ensures long-term stability, especially in areas with heavy rainfall or high humidity across both urban and rural Victoria.
Widely Compatible with Engineering Standards
Concrete sleeper walls integrated with galvanised steel posts are extensively documented in engineering designs and comply with AS 4678 for earth-retaining structures. Their performance under load conditions is predictable, supporting confidence in structural calculations.
Straightforward Installation and Repair Process
Contractors value the simplicity of working with concrete sleepers and steel posts. Their standardised dimensions reduce fabrication time, and if a section requires replacement, it can typically be done without dismantling large portions of the wall.
When constructing retaining walls in Victoria’s reactive clay zones, proper engineering practices ensure maximum effectiveness and longevity when using concrete sleepers and galvanised steel posts. While these materials are inherently durable, correct installation and site preparation are essential for safety and compliance.
Foundation preparation must include proper compaction and drainage. A trench with a compacted gravel base ensures even load distribution underneath concrete sleepers. Incorporating perforated drainage pipes behind the wall prevents hydrostatic pressure build-up during extreme weather.
Galvanised steel posts must be set deep enough to provide adequate anchoring—typically half their total length in stable soil. Engineers recommend using concrete encasement at the base to prevent wobble and lateral movement.
Always ensure concrete sleepers meet relevant Australian Standards for compressive strength and dimensional accuracy. At FPM Building Supplies, inventory is sourced to meet or exceed these benchmarks, offering consistency across multiple job sites.
Regular inspections for post alignment and sleeper levelness during installation help prevent long-term wall bowing or failure—common issues in areas with soil expansion.

Are concrete sleepers and galvanised steel posts still compliant with current building regulations?
Yes—these materials continue to meet AS 4678 and National Construction Code requirements for structural integrity, safety, and performance in retaining wall applications, including areas with reactive soil.
How do these materials perform in high-moisture or coastal conditions?
Concrete sleepers handle moisture exceptionally well, while the galvanised coating on steel posts provides long-term corrosion resistance. For coastal exposure, additional protective coatings can be applied where necessary.
